As gamers gear up for May, NVIDIA maintains its usual pace 16 new titles for GeForce NOW. This month’s lineup includes highly sought-after AAA games across various platforms, allowing members to access their libraries instantly on a wide range of devices.
The excitement peaks with the launch of Forza, among other major titles, available on release day through Steam, Xbox, PC Game Pass, and GOG. This move significantly enhances the service’s catalog, catering to gamers eager for fresh content.
During the rollout, the platform also benefits from the performance boost of the new GeForce RTX 5080 graphics cards. These enhancements promise improved streaming quality and smoother gameplay, increasing user satisfaction and engagement.
